comparison org/vamp_plugins/test.java @ 21:0a91d898acc3

Finish implementation of RealTime; add dispose() calls
author Chris Cannam
date Thu, 09 Feb 2012 16:18:33 +0000
parents 5b0847d344c3
children
comparison
equal deleted inserted replaced
20:cf6c69871f9c 21:0a91d898acc3
78 } 78 }
79 RealTime timestamp = RealTime.frame2RealTime(block * 1024, 44100); 79 RealTime timestamp = RealTime.frame2RealTime(block * 1024, 44100);
80 TreeMap<Integer, ArrayList<Feature>> 80 TreeMap<Integer, ArrayList<Feature>>
81 features = p.process(buffers, timestamp); 81 features = p.process(buffers, timestamp);
82 82
83 timestamp.dispose();
84
83 printFeatures(features); 85 printFeatures(features);
84 } 86 }
85 87
86 TreeMap<Integer, ArrayList<Feature>> 88 TreeMap<Integer, ArrayList<Feature>>
87 features = p.getRemainingFeatures(); 89 features = p.getRemainingFeatures();
88 90
89 System.out.println("Results from getRemainingFeatures:"); 91 System.out.println("Results from getRemainingFeatures:");
90 92
91 printFeatures(features); 93 printFeatures(features);
94 p.dispose();
92 95
93 } catch (PluginLoader.LoadFailedException e) { 96 } catch (PluginLoader.LoadFailedException e) {
94 System.out.println("Plugin load failed"); 97 System.out.println("Plugin load failed");
95 } 98 }
96 } 99 }